T-Deliver Project Training and Documentation

Delivering documentation, training, or coaching is becoming more virtual & integrated within the deliverables.

  • These are behavioral deliverables, their purpose is to influence and change human behavior while using and or in support of the project's solution deliverables.

  • Successful Projects produce expected business results by creating desirable human and machine behavior

  • We want people to use the new solution in a particular way

  • We want employees to use the new software, to follow the new procedure

  • We want customers to buy the new product

  • These are all behaviors

  • Measurable results will change when the human and software / machine behavior changes using the project's deliverables

Documentation:

  • Ensure resources are available to deliver required documentation.

  • Establish methods to receive feedback regarding the documentation that's delivered.

  • Have resources identified and available to respond to documentation feedback and to enhance or update the documentation.

  • Establish methods to monitor performance of the documentation.

Training:

  • Ensure resources are available to deliver required training.

  • Establish methods to receive feedback regarding the training that's delivered.

  • Have resources identified and available to respond to training feedback and to enhance or update the training.

  • Establish methods to monitor performance of the training.

Coaching:

  • Ensure resources are available to deliver required coaching.

  • Establish methods to receive feedback regarding the coaching that's delivered.

  • Have resources identified and available to respond to coaching feedback and to enhance or update the coaching.

  • Establish methods to monitor performance of the coaching.
